Browntown, WI and Cambria, WI have a very similar cost of living, with only a 1% difference in their overall index. Browntown scores 66 while Cambria scores 67 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Browntown is $775/month compared to $700/month in Cambria — a 11%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Cambria has cheaper rent, Browntown actually has lower median home values ($113,200 vs $149,300).

Median household income in Browntown is $70,500 compared to $69,375 in Cambria (+1.6%). Browntown off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Browntown spend roughly 13.2% of their income on rent, more than the 12.1% in Cambria.
